DeMatha Catholic High School is a four-year Catholic high school for boys located in Hyattsville, Maryland, United States. Named after John of Matha , DeMatha is under the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Washington and is a member of the Washington Catholic Athletic Conference .
DeMatha Catholic High School's second decade was one of growth: in popularity, enrollment, and physical size. The humble days of 18 students in the Monastery basement were long gone as the school boomed to a student population of over 450 students by the mid-1960's.

The DeMatha athletic department has garnered over 200 league championships in the Washington Catholic Athletic Conference (WCAC) since the school won its first championship in 1957.
